What is Davis Commodities Other Current Payables?

Davis Commodities DTCKF +1.00% 24 Other Current Payables is $1.4 Mil as of Dec. 2025. GuruFocus rates DTCKF with a GF Score™ of 24/100. The stock has 2 warning signs investors should review.

Davis Commodities's Other Current Payables for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2025 was $1.4 Mil.

Davis Commodities's quarterly Other Current Payables declined from Dec. 2024 ($0.5 Mil) to Jun. 2025 ($0.3 Mil) but then increased from Jun. 2025 ($0.3 Mil) to Dec. 2025 ($1.4 Mil).

Davis Commodities's annual Other Current Payables declined from Dec. 2023 ($1.1 Mil) to Dec. 2024 ($0.5 Mil) but then increased from Dec. 2024 ($0.5 Mil) to Dec. 2025 ($1.4 Mil).

Davis Commodities Other Current Payables Calculation

Other Current Payables is the payables owed and expected to be paid within one year or one operating cycle that not otherwise classified. It includes dividends payable and all other current payables.

Davis Commodities Business Description

Address 10 Bukit Batok Crescent, No. 10-01, The Spire, Singapore, SGP, 658079
Davis Commodities Ltd is an agricultural commodity trading company based in Singapore, which specializes in the trading of three main categories of agricultural commodities, namely sugar, rice, and oil and fat products. It distributes agricultural commodities to various markets, including Asia, Africa, and the Middle East. The company also provides customers of commodity offerings with complementary, ancillary services such as warehouse handling and storage, and logistics services. The Company operates across four main segments: the sale of sugar, rice, oil, and fat products, and others. Among these, the sale of sugar stands out as the primary revenue generator, contributing significantly to the company's overall income.
